Does the Bin Yue feature one-key start?

The Bin Yue features one-key start, and the operation method is as follows: 1. First press the start button, wait for the ACC light to illuminate, then press the start button again. At this point, the one-key start button turns green, and the vehicle performs a self-check; 2. After the vehicle completes the self-check, press the brake and press the one-key start button once more to start the vehicle. In terms of power, the Bin Yue offers two engine options: 1.0T and 1.5T. The transmission system is paired with either a 7-speed wet dual-clutch transmission or a 6-speed manual transmission. The 1.5T turbocharged engine, jointly developed by Geely and Volvo, delivers a maximum power of 130 kW and a peak torque of 255 N·m.

How to set the automatic locking function for the Honda Avancier?

The method to set the automatic locking function for the Honda Avancier is to press and hold the lock button for 6 seconds until the security indicator flashes twice. The purpose of the automatic locking function is anti-theft. The doors will automatically lock when the vehicle reaches a certain speed after starting, preventing door-pull robberies during traffic jams or at red lights, providing a certain level of security. Taking the 2020 Honda Avancier as an example, its body structure is a 5-door, 5-seat SUV with dimensions of length 4858mm, width 1942mm, height 1670mm, and a wheelbase of 2820mm. It has a fuel tank capacity of 57 liters, a trunk capacity of 510 liters, and a curb weight of 1801kg.

What is the fuel consumption of the Toyota 2700?

According to the comprehensive fuel consumption data from the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ology, the Toyota Prado 2700 has a fuel consumption of 9.2L/100km. However, based on actual measurements from some Toyota Prado 2700 owners, the fuel consumption is generally around 11L/100km. The fuel consumption may vary depending on the driver's habits and road conditions. Below are some tips for saving fuel in your car: 1. Use high-quality fuel: When refueling, try to use high-quality fuel as it burns more efficiently, helping your car save fuel. 2. Avoid aggressive acceleration and braking: While driving, try to avoid aggressive acceleration and braking to prevent engine overload. 3. Regular maintenance: Clean engine carbon deposits and fuel lines regularly to ensure better fuel combustion.

How to Measure Tire Size in Inches

Methods for measuring tire size include: 1. Use a metal tape measure to wrap around the tire along the centerline of the tread or the highest point near the centerline to measure the outer circumference; 2. Select a section of the tire sidewall without markings, decorative lines, or protective strips, and use a vernier caliper or calipers to measure the cross-sectional width at approximately four equally spaced points around the tire. The functions of tires are: 1. To prevent severe vibrations and premature damage to automotive components, adapt to the high-speed performance of vehicles, and reduce driving noise; 2. To support the entire weight of the vehicle, bear the load of the car, and transmit forces and moments in other directions; 3. To transmit traction and braking torque, ensuring good adhesion between the wheels and the road surface to improve the vehicle's power, braking, and off-road performance.

How to Turn on the Heating in Tiggo 8?

Tiggo 8's heating can be turned on by following these steps: 1. Start the car and press the air conditioning power or auto button to activate the air conditioning; 2. Wait for the water temperature to rise, then turn on the AC button and adjust the temperature knob to the red zone. Taking the 2020 Tiggo 8 as an example, its body dimensions are: length 4700mm, width 1860mm, height 1746mm, with a wheelbase of 2710mm. The 2020 Tiggo 8 is equipped with a 1.5T turbocharged engine, delivering a maximum power of 115kW and a maximum torque of 230Nm, paired with a 6-speed manual transmission. It features a front MacPherson independent suspension and a rear multi-link independent suspension.

Why does the car dashboard show abnormal tire pressure?

The reasons why the car dashboard shows abnormal tire pressure are: 1. The tire pressure is not within the normal range; 2. The tire is leaking or punctured, causing insufficient air pressure; 3. The tire pressure is too high. Tire pressure refers to the air pressure inside the tire. The effects of excessive tire pressure are: 1. It affects the braking performance and driving comfort of the car; 2. Excessive tire pressure increases the friction between the tire and the ground, reducing tire adhesion; 3. It accelerates the wear of the central tread pattern, shortening the tire's service life. The effects of insufficient tire pressure are: 1. It accelerates rubber aging and increases tire wear; 2. It causes the tire body to expand, making it prone to cracks on both the inner and outer sides; 3. It increases the contact area between the tire and the ground, causing the tire to overheat.
